Bendigo bank is big on community spirit and banking local. Most are run by a board of local towns people. Once a year community groups can apply for funding, which the board allocate what funds to which group. Most of the board or their wives or husbands or children are in these “groups” so funding gets allocated to who they choose. It’s very biased and unfair. The fees and charges on all accounts are ridiculous the highest of any bank. I personally would never bank with Bendigo bank again. Once my credit card is paid out that is the last account I have with them to close. I liked the idea of support your local community ect but once I found out how it works, I’m appalled at the behaviour.
